Problem & Solution

Traditional stovetop and oven cooking methods frequently suffer from uneven temperature control, leading to overcooked outer edges and undercooked centers in meats and vegetables. Achieving restaurant-grade edge-to-edge precision usually requires constant monitoring and expensive, specialized commercial equipment.

The Wancle 1100W Sous Vide Cooker addresses this by maintaining a continuously circulated, temperature-controlled water bath. Its high 1100W output ensures efficient heating, while the integrated IPX7 waterproof rating safeguards internal electronic components from steam accumulation and accidental submersion during long cooking cycles.

Key Features

  • 1100W Heating Output
    Delivers rapid water heating and consistent temperature stability during extended immersion cooking.
  • IPX7 Waterproof Rating
    Offers high protection against steam ingress and accidental water immersion in the kitchen.
  • Digital LCD Touch Panel
    Allows clear reading and simple adjustments of cooking parameters directly on the stick.
  • Continuous Immersion Circulator
    Keeps water moving evenly throughout the container to eliminate cold thermal pockets.

Is It Worth Buying?

The Wancle 1100W Sous Vide Cooker provides essential core capabilities for precise water bath cooking. The 1100W heating element enables efficient temperature ramp-ups, while the IPX7 waterproof standard tackles one of the most common points of failure in budget immersion sticks—internal electronics ruined by rising steam or accidental drops into the pot.

For cooks who value simplicity, the built-in LCD touch screen makes set-up quick without relying on mobile apps, smart home hubs, or Bluetooth range limitations. However, if you rely on mobile push notifications, recipe presets via an app, or remote temperature tracking while away from the kitchen, the lack of confirmed wireless capabilities may be a deal-breaker.

Before ordering, consider the depth and type of pots or containers you intend to use, as physical dimensions and clamp specs are not explicitly listed in the available data.
